Area contextNeighborhood Overview – Palisade High School (Palisade, CO)
Nestled in Colorado's Grand Valley, Palisade High School is situated in the heart of Palisade, a town renowned for its peaches and vineyards. The school is easily accessible via Interstate 70, with the main exit leading directly to the business district and local amenities. The primary access road is G Road, which runs perpendicular to the interstate ramps and bisects the town. Parking at the school is generally available on campus in designated lots, though it can become crowded during major sporting events or school assemblies. The nearest major airport is Grand Junction Regional Airport (GJT), located about a 20-minute drive east of Palisade. Driving times from the airport to the school are typically under 30 minutes, depending on traffic. Public transportation options within Palisade are limited, making a personal vehicle or rideshare service the most convenient ways to reach the school and explore the surrounding area. For events, arriving at least 45-60 minutes prior to game time is recommended to secure parking and navigate any potential bottlenecks at the school's entrances.

Colorado Welcome Center at Palisade
The Colorado Welcome Center at Palisade serves as a crucial information hub for visitors exploring the Grand Valley. Staff here can provide maps, brochures, and expert advice on local attractions, wineries, orchards, and outdoor activities. They are particularly knowledgeable about the peak seasons for fruit harvesting and local events. It's also a convenient place to grab a restroom break and often features displays on regional history and points of interest, making it a great first stop for anyone new to the area.
Palisade · 1.7 miPalisade Rim Trail
The Palisade Rim Trail offers a scenic hiking and biking experience with stunning panoramic views of the Grand Valley, the Colorado River, and the surrounding Book Cliffs. This trail system features various routes catering to different fitness levels, from moderate climbs to more challenging ascents. The relatively dry climate of the region makes it an accessible outdoor activity for much of the year. It’s an ideal spot for individuals or groups looking to stretch their legs and enjoy the natural beauty of Western Colorado after a day of sporting events.

Weather & Seasons at Palisade High School
- Winter: Winter in Palisade typically brings cool to cold temperatures, with average highs in the 40s Fahrenheit and lows often dipping below freezing. Snowfall is possible but usually not heavy or persistent, though icy conditions can occur. Visitors should pack warm layers, including a coat, hat, and gloves, for outdoor events. Shorter daylight hours mean planning arrival and departure times around available light is important.
- Spring & early summer: Spring ushers in warming temperatures, with highs climbing into the 60s and 70s Fahrenheit, though evenings can remain cool. This is a beautiful time as orchards blossom. Lightweight jackets or hoodies are practical for layering. Early summer continues this trend, leading into the hotter months, making comfortable, breathable clothing suitable for outdoor events increasingly necessary.
- Mid-summer: Mid-summer brings the heat to Palisade, with average daytime temperatures often reaching into the 80s and 90s Fahrenheit, sometimes exceeding 100°F. Light, moisture-wicking clothing is essential for comfort. Sunscreen, hats, and plenty of water are highly recommended for anyone spending time outdoors at the school or nearby attractions. Hydration is key, and shaded areas become valuable during peak sun hours.
- Fall season: Fall offers pleasant, crisp weather as temperatures begin to cool, with highs typically in the 60s and 70s Fahrenheit, dropping into the 40s overnight. This season is ideal for outdoor activities, and visitors should pack layers, including sweaters or light jackets, for fluctuating temperatures. The vibrant autumn colors add to the scenic beauty of the region.
- Rain & snow: Rainfall is generally light throughout the year in Palisade, with slightly more precipitation possible in spring and fall. Snow is infrequent and usually melts quickly, though periods of freezing rain or sleet can create slick conditions on roads and walkways. Always check local weather forecasts before traveling, especially during winter months, and be prepared for potential travel disruptions if significant winter weather is expected.
